Heads of department should be aware that Quillhaven Manufacturing remains our sole supplier for the Tarnwick actuator series, creating material continuity risk. Procurement has screened four candidate firms in the Eastmere region; two passed preliminary quality audits, and sample runs are scheduled for next quarter. Qualification costs are estimated at a manageable level within existing budgets, though tooling lead times are long. Please treat candidate names as sensitive. The underlying business context is set out directly below.

management briefing: The southern region missed its Oliox quota by 51.7 percent last quarter. Juldorek Freight plans to raise the Silath list price by 49.7 percent in January. The board signed off on a budget of $388.0 million for Project Casok. The renewal with Fradorix Foods closes at $53.0 million a year, 49.8 percent below the last contract.

## Releases

Hey support folks — quick notes on ProfileMesh shard releases. Each release re-balances user-profile shards gradually, so don't panic if a lookup lands on a stale shard for a few minutes post-deploy; it self-heals. Release bundles are published twice a month and are always signed. If a customer asks you to verify a bundle they downloaded, walk them through the checksum step using the public signing key below.

deploy key for kawif-bageg: bky19_YQNdHDgpaLxUNwPoHm9

# Break-Glass: Catalog Cache Invalidation

Scope: the Pinrow product catalog at Veldstone Retail. If stale prices persist after a purge and the Hollowmere invalidation queue is wedged, use break-glass to flush the edge tier directly. Contractors: get verbal sign-off from the catalog lead first. Steps: open the Hollowmere admin shell, select emergency-flush, confirm the tenant, and run it once — repeated flushes thrash the origin. Access is logged and expires after 20 minutes. Unseal the admin shell with the passphrase below.

recovery phrase for kahop-tajog: istix-casvan